Try NowNEW DELHI: The Indian Institute of Science Education and Research (IISER) will release the IISER admission test 2022 application form at iiseradmission.in. Candidates will be able to fill the IISER application form in online mode from April 25. The application process of IISER 2022 will consist of registration, filling application form, uploading documents and payment of fee. The last date of IISER registration 2022 is May 20.
Along with the application form dates, the officials have also announced the IISER 2022 exam date. IISER Admission Test 2022 will be conducted on June 12. Check the important dates and IISER 2022 registration process from below.

How to fill IISER 2022 application form?
-
Visit the IISER 2022 official website - iiseradmission.in.
-
Click on the “IISER registration 2022” link and complete the process.
-
Proceed with the help of allotted credentials to fill the application form of IISER 2022.
-
Pay application fee in online mode.
-
Preview and submit the IISER admission test application form.
IISER admission test 2022: What’s new this year?
The authorities have announced a change in marking pattern of IISER admission test 2022. This year, three marks will be awarded for each correct answer while one-fourth marks will be deducted for each incorrect answer. However, no marks will be deducted for an unanswered question.
